The Hurricanes will be welcoming back a critical piece of their back end for tonight’s game against Seattle. The team announced that defenseman Jaccob Slavin has been activated off injured reserve.
The Carolina Hurricanes activated defenseman Jaccob Slavin from injured reserve on Saturday after missing 10 games with an upper-body injury. The 31-year-old Slavin has only played in five games in 2025-26, missing a total of 39 due to injury.

An already-active winter for NHL roster movement could get even more busy in short order. According to a report from Sportsnet’s Elliotte Friedman, the Carolina Hurricanes are actively weighing trade offers for center Jesperi Kotkaniemi.
According to Elliotte Friedman of Sportsnet, one name to keep a close eye on is Carolina’s Jesperi Kotkaniemi. Already the subject of trade rumors in connection to a failed Phillip Danault trade, and the Hurricanes’ chase to land Quinn Hughes out of Vancouver.
The Carolina Hurricanes are reportedly considering trade offers for center Jesperi Kotkaniemi, Sportsnet’s Elliotte Friedman reported this morning. According to Friedman, the Hurricanes “recognize [Kotkaniemi] needs a fresh start” and are considering trade offers for the 25-year-old pivot at this time.

The Carolina Hurricanes and Utah Mammoth have completed a late-night trade. The Hurricanes acquired defenseman Juuso Välimäki from the Mammoth in exchange for future considerations and assigned him to the AHL’s Chicago Wolves.
